French President Emmanuel Macron and his wife Brigitte are currently making headlines after a video of one of their actions together went viral. In the clip, shared on social media on Sunday, Brigitte Macron appears to punch her husband in the face after landing in Vietnam. Despite the surprising incident, which was documented in TV images, Emmanuel Macron reacts calmly and waves to the waiting photographers.
They both leave the plane together, with Macron offering his arm to Brigitte. She ignores his gesture and instead holds on to the railing. The Elysée Palace has already characterized the incident as a moment of "letting off steam" and "fooling around" between the couple. Emmanuel Macron himself emphasizes that they were just “fooling around” and criticizes the supposedly incorrect interpretation of the video. He also appeals to the public to “calm down,” as other videos of his have been misunderstood in the past, such as those about cocaine and his statements about a dispute with the Turkish president.
An extraordinary love
Emmanuel and Brigitte Macron's relationship is characterized by a notable age difference. They first met at the Lycée La Providence in Amiens when Emmanuel was 15 and Brigitte was 24 years older and married to André-Louis Auzière at the time. The two worked together on the play “The Art Of Comedy” at the time. Their relationship developed during rehearsals and was noticed by classmates at a graduation party. Although Macron was sent to Paris by his parents to attend another school, his interest in Brigitte remained.
Brigitte was 39 years old at the start of their relationship and already had three children who were of a similar age to Macron. After a long, cautious phase, they married on October 20, 2007. This decision was not easy for Brigitte as she previously feared that the relationship would put a strain on her children. International attention to the couple increased in 2017 when Emmanuel Macron won the first round of the presidential election, with Brigitte always supporting him and appearing publicly alongside him.
